Sunnyside sits in the Pacific Northwest. In 2024 it voted Democratic.
Across the recorded series it reached a Democratic high of 30.5 points in 2020. Between 2020 and 2024 the city moved 20.8 points toward the Republican candidate; the 2024 margin was 9.7 points.
A population of 16,277, a 34% non-Hispanic-white share, and a median household income of $60,923 describe the city.
